Viscous Flow through Porous Media
The resistance of a porous medium to a fluid streaming through it is estimated by minimizing the rate of energy dissipation for a class of trial stress distributions. Rigorously valid lower bounds on the resistance are obtained in terms of certain two- and three-point averages characterizing the medium.

Fusogenic RNA Nanomodules for Fusion‐Mediated and Multiplexed siRNA Delivery
A fusogenic lipid‐layered RNA nanomodules (L‐CRAMs) enable high‐capacity and long‐lasting siRNA delivery through membrane fusion. These nanomodules carry exceptionally large siRNA payloads, avoid conventional endosomal uptake, and release multiple functional siRNAs through Dicer‐mediated processing.
